An Operating System is the basic software which manages a computer system. It takes care of the way the hardware behaves, the communication with peripherals such as a monitor, a printer or a keyboard, the allocation of memory between various applications, and the prioritization of applications when multiple ones run at once. Every program that is installed on a notebook or a desktop works by sending requests to the OS for various services by using an application program interface (API). The contact with the OS can be achieved through a Graphical User Interface (GUI) or a command line. In the web hosting field, the OS is what commands a web hosting server as well as any software installed on it, which includes not only website scripts, but also any other application for instance a VOIP or a game server. When there're virtual machines created, they work with a guest OS which is run on the server host OS.
